Pismo Pier Plaza

The Pismo Pier Plaza project stemmed from the Pismo Beach Downtown Core Vision and Strategic Plan that RRM completed in 2014. Driven by community input, the project team made an array of updates and renovations to modernize the plaza that was last worked on by RRM back in 1986. Iconic, 8-foot tall Pismo Beach letters act as a central photo-op spot at the center of the plaza. Paving throughout this central area is formatted in a diamond format to mimic the diamond format of the pier itself. Behind the letters, nestled in the corner of the plaza, RRM designed a beachfront park that boasts an array of beach themed play structures. A breaching humpback whale is the iconic centerpiece of this unexpected play area in addition to surfboard seating areas. The beautiful pieces were chosen not only for their striking sculptural quality but also for their natural wood construction that will withstand the unforgiving ocean environment better than steel. All the play experiences are at ground level, and the protective surfacing blends seamlessly into the surrounding plaza pavement, making the environment barrier-free. But by popular vote, the highlight of the plaza is two concrete slides that whisk giddy beachgoers of all ages from the plaza onto the sand 16-feet below – putting an exclamation mark on a memorable experience. Additional improvements include accessible access to the beach, a dedicated airstream section of the Pier for local businesses and restaurants, as well as a newly constructed restroom that seamlessly blends in with the pier.
